Subject: Recalled chargers — pallet pickup Friday

Hi dispatch team,

The pallet of recalled Voltbridge chargers is shrink-wrapped and waiting at dock two. Returns paperwork is taped to the side in the clear sleeve. Norfell Logistics collects Friday morning; please have the dock clear by 08:00. Before the driver leaves, pass along this instruction:

handover note for kagep-kagup: the holok holdor courier leaves the rusix sorox fenwyn ledger at gate 3590 under passcode 092644

- [ ] **Step 7: Breaker override escrow.** After sealing the signing keys for the Tallgrove upstream API circuit breaker, confirm the support team can force the breaker open during a full outage. The override bundle lives in the sealed escrow drawer and is useless without its unlock phrase. Two ceremony witnesses must initial this step before proceeding. The escrow bundle is decrypted with the recovery passphrase that follows.

vault phrase of kahip-kahop = holath-quenmir

Handover — Vexler partner SFTP drop

Ownership moves to you today. Drop runs hourly from Vexler's end into the intake bucket via the relay host. Watch for zero-byte files; their exporter flakes on Mondays. Creds live in the ops vault, path noted in the runbook. Vault auto-seals after 48h idle. Support escalations go to the on-call rotation, not me. If the vault is sealed when you need it, unseal with the recovery passphrase below.

recovery phrase for tadug-fafof: zorwyn-kasion

Service accounts for Stagecraft, our seat-map renderer for the Gildenhall Theatre project, live on this page. Each environment gets its own account — don't reuse the staging one in prod, please, we've been burned before. The renderer calls the internal Seatsmith layout service on every map load, so your local setup needs a valid key. The current staging key is below.

gateway credential: kto3_qfe